Annonse

hvordan du kan kryptere filer i LinuxMark har tidligere beskrevet hvordan du kan bruke TrueCrypt for å kryptere sensitive data. Selv om det er en flott krypteringsprogramvare, krever den at du forhåndsdeler en fast størrelse til beholderen før du kan lagre konfidensielle data til den. Hvis du bare bruker 10% av den tildelte plassen, går de resterende 90% av plassen til spill. Hvis du leter etter en mer dynamisk løsning for å kryptere filer i Linux, kan eCryptfs være løsningen for deg.

eCryptfs er et stablet kryptografisk filsystem innebygd i Linux-kjernen (versjoner 2.6.19 og nyere). Som et stablet filsystem, kan det enkelt kryptere og dekryptere filene på din Linux-PC når de er skrevet til eller lest fra harddisken.

Den største fordelen med eCryptfs er at all kryptering er laget på enkeltfilnivå. Dette betyr at du ikke trenger å lage en beholder med fast størrelse for å holde filene dine.

Det er flere fordeler med kryptering av enkelt filnivå:

  • Siden hver fil blir behandlet på en annen måte, på en delt plattform / server / katalog, kan du ha forskjellige filer kryptert av forskjellige brukere, og hver bruker kan bare få tilgang til filene sine.
    instagram viewer
  • Alle kryptografiske metadata lagres i overskriften på filen. Dette betyr at den krypterte filen kan kopieres / flyttes fra ett sted til et annet uten å miste konfidensialiteten.
  • Det krever ingen spesiell tildeling for lagringsallokering på disk. Du trenger ikke å forhåndsallokere 1 GB (eller mer) av harddiskplassen for å lagre sensitive data som kanskje bare er få megabyte.

Installere eCryptfs

Installasjonsmetoden kan variere i forskjellige distroser. I Ubuntu 8.04 og over kan du installere eCryptfs ved å bruke følgende kommando:

sudo aptitude installer ecryptfs-utils

For Ubuntu 8.10

Ettersom eCryptfs er implementert i Ubuntu 8.10, kan du enkelt konfigurere det ved hjelp av følgende kommando:

eCryptfs-setup-privat

Når du har satt opp Ubuntu 8.10, vil du finne en Privat -mappen i hjemmekatalogen. For å få tilgang til mappen, må du montere den med denne kommandoen:

mount.ecryptfs_private

Du kan nå legge til sensitive filer i Privat mappe. Kryptering vil bli gjort når filen legges til i mappen.

For å avmontere mappen bruker du kommandoen:

umount.ecryptfs_private

For Ubuntu 8.04 eller annen Ubuntu-basert distro

Opprett først en mappe i hjemmekatalogen, og navng den hemmelig

mkdir ~ / hemmelighet

Endre filtillatelsen slik at bare du får tilgang

chmod 700 ~ / hemmelighet

Monter eCryptfs til hemmelig mappe

sudo mount -t ecryptfs ~ / secret ~ / secret

Den vil be deg om å svare på noen få spørsmål:

1) Velge nøkkeltype for nyopprettede filer

ecryptfs opplæring

Trykk på ‘1’ for å velge passordfrase

2) Velge krypteringskryptering

eCryptfs-chiffer

Trykk Enter for å velge standardalternativet [AES]

3) Velg tastebytes

eCryptfs-keybyte

Trykk Enter for å velge standardalternativet [16]

4) Aktiver gjennomgang gjennom ren tekst

Skriv ‘N’ for å velge Nei.

Det er det. Du kan nå legge til filer i hemmelig mappe.

For å teste påliteligheten til eCryptfs, må du demontere hemmelig mappen og se om du kan åpne filene i mappen.

sudo umount ~ / hemmelighet

Hvis alt er bra, skal du ikke kunne åpne noen filer i mappen.

Hvilke andre krypteringsmetoder bruker du for å beskytte filene dine?

Damien Oh er en helt teknologisk geek som elsker å finpusse og hacke forskjellige operativsystemer for å gjøre livet enklere. Sjekk ut bloggen hans på MakeTechEasier.com der han deler alle tips, triks og opplæringsprogrammer.